How does a word make the jump from the citation file to the dictionary? The process begins with dictionary editors reviewing groups of citations. Definers start by looking at citations covering a relatively small segment of the alphabet – for examplegri-togro-– along with the entries from ...

"I rhyme with now. I am a..." and so on. I spy: This is a simple word game most people know. Spot something nearby and tell your child the sound or letter it begins with. They must look around and try to guess what it is you "spied." Does your child love playing I spy?
